「贝格迈思」分布式智能数据库 AiSQL通过深交所测试,以异构智能...
具体来看,为确保数据处理的高效性和智能性,AiSQL整合了机器学习和人工智能技术,包括BrightML机器学习平台和GPT智能引擎,以及向量数据引擎和大模型驱动的智能计算能力;安全层面,AiSQL结合了可查询压缩和可检索加密技术,提供了金融级别的数据安全保障。而HTAP与NewSQL的结合,让数据库更具多场景适应性。同时,分布式技术与...
SQL 查询语句总是先执行 SELECT?你们都错了
(不行,窗口函数是SELECT语句里,而SELECT是在WHERE和GROUPBY之后)可以基于GROUPBY里的东西进行ORDERBY吗?(可以,ORDERBY基本上是在最后执行的,所以可以基于任何东西进行ORDERBY)LIMIT是在什么时候执行?(在最后!)但数据库引擎并不一定严格按照这个顺序执行SQL查询,因为为了更快地执...
走向DBA[MSSQL篇] - 从SQL语句的角度提高数据库的访问性能
执行计划是数据库根据SQL语句和相关表的统计信息作出的一个查询方案,这个方案是由查询优化器自动分析产生的,比如一条SQL语句如果用来从一个10万条记录的表中查1条记录,那查询优化器会选择“索引查找”方式,如果该表进行了归档,当前只剩下5000条记录了,那查询优化器就会改变方案,采用“全表扫描”方式。可见,执行计...
阿里P8架构师谈:MySQL数据库的索引原理、与慢SQL优化的5大原则
每个磁盘块的数据项的数量是m,则有h=㏒(m+1)N,当数据量N一定的情况下,m越大,h越小;而m=磁盘块的大小/数据项的大小,磁盘块的大小也就是一个数据页的大小,是固定的,如果数据项占的空间越小,数据项的数量越多,树的高度越低。
产品经理对数据库不必懂太多,这篇总结就够了!
应用数据库常用查询语句一、产品经理对数据库掌握两点随着业务横向扩展,数据维度在扩大。随着业务纵深发展,数据量在倍增。随之而来的,是数据结构的不兼容、数据存储不够用,数据服务性能见拙,一切当初未考虑到的,都成了滋生障碍的伏笔。产品不了解数据库原理的话,常常会与技术方案之间信息割裂。近期表现为互相扯皮...
Python数据库ORM工具sqlalchemy的学习笔记
下面是连接和使用sqlite数据库的例子1.connection使用传统的connection的方式连接和操作数据库fromsqlalchemyimportcreate_engine#数据库连接字符串DB_CONNECT_STRING='sqlite/:memory:'#创建数据库引擎,echo为True,会打印所有的sql语句engine=create_engine(DB_CONNECT_STRING,echo=True)...
技多不压身 | 产品经理需知的那些数据库基础知识
SQL(StructuredQueryLanguage)是结构化查询语言,可以用来和数据库通信,绝大部分DBMS都支持SQL,简单的说就是通过编写SQL语句来操作数据库。在下面的操作中,笔者也将以MySQL+Navicat作为基础开发环境,以SQL语法为说明。MySQL安装教程:httpsrunoob/mysql/mysql-install.html...
SQL优化13连问,收藏好!
对于一些经常被查询的数据,可以使用缓存优化。使用Redis等缓存中间件来缓存常用的数据,以减少查询数据库的次数,提高查询效率。SQL语句优化在编写SQL查询语句时,要尽可能地简单明了,避免复杂的查询语句,同时也要避免一些不必要的查询操作。对于复杂的查询语句,可以使用Explain执行计划来进行优化。同时也要注意避免使用OR...
春眠不觉晓,SQL 知多少?|原力计划
增强了MERGE和DIAGNOSTIC语句。支持TRUNCATETABLE语句CASE表达式支持逗号分隔的WHEN子句。INSTEADOF触发器。JOIN分区表。FETCH子句。允许游标定义之外的ORDERBY。支持各种XQuery正则表达式/模式匹配。派生字段名增强。SQL:2006SQL:2006定义了SQL操作XML的方式。它定义了在SQL数据库中导入...
30个Oracle语句优化规则详解(1)
可惜的是Oracle只对简单的表提供高速缓冲(cachebuffering),这个功能并不适用于多表连接查询。数据库管理员必须在init.ora中为这个区域设置合适的参数,当这个内存区域越大,就可以保留更多的语句,当然被共享的可能性也就越大了。当你向Oracle提交一个SQL语句,Oracle会首先在这块内存中查找相同的语句。